Mold Clearance Certificate Dubai: What It Means – What a Mold Clearance Certificate Dubai Means in Practice
A mold clearance certificate is a formal document issued by a qualified indoor environmental professional or accredited laboratory following post-remediation verification. It states, based on physical inspection and laboratory-confirmed sampling, that the affected area no longer contains mold contamination at levels considered problematic for indoor occupancy.
Critically, a clearance certificate is not issued by the remediation contractor themselves. Issuing and verifying are two different functions, and any credible mold clearance certificate Dubai process separates them. The party that cleaned the property should not be the same party confirming the outcome — that separation is what gives the document its integrity. What the certificate typically documents includes:
- The property address and the specific areas assessed
- The date of post-remediation inspection (DD/MM/YYYY format)
- The sampling methodology used (air sampling, surface sampling, or both)
- Laboratory results from an accredited testing facility
- The professional’s interpretation of results against accepted indoor environmental benchmarks
- A conclusion statement confirming clearance or identifying areas requiring further attention

Mold Clearance Certificate Dubai: What It Means – When Is a Mold Clearance Certificate Required in Dubai
Several situations in Dubai and the wider UAE commonly trigger the need for a mold clearance certificate. Property transactions are one of the most frequent drivers. Buyers conducting due diligence on villas in areas like Arabian Ranches, The Springs, or Jumeirah Islands — where older building envelopes can hide years of moisture accumulation — may request a clearance certificate before completing a purchase.
Rental disputes resolved through the Dubai Rental Disputes Centre or RERA-related proceedings can also involve mold clearance documentation, particularly when tenants raise indoor environmental concerns. Facility managers in commercial and hospitality settings may require clearance documentation as part of their health and safety audit trail. Post-renovation mold clearance is another common scenario. Construction work that opens up wall cavities, disturbs existing materials, or introduces moisture through wet trades can release previously contained contamination. A mold clearance certificate Dubai assessment conducted after renovation confirms that materials are clean before new finishes are applied.
Healthcare facilities, nurseries, and childcare centres in the UAE operate under heightened indoor environmental standards, and mold clearance documentation may form part of ongoing regulatory compliance requirements for those settings. Mold Clearance Certificate Dubai: What It Means – The Mold Clearance Certificate Dubai Assessment Process Step
Step One: Post-Remediation Stabilisation
Before any clearance sampling begins, the remediated area must be physically stable. Containment barriers used during remediation should be intact or correctly removed, surfaces must be dry, and the HVAC system — if it was part of the affected zone — should be operational at normal settings. Sampling conducted in an environment that is still drying or still disturbed will not yield results that accurately reflect the cleared state.
Step Two: Visual Inspection by a Qualified Professional
A clearance assessment begins with a thorough visual inspection of the remediated area and surrounding zones. This is where building science training becomes important. An assessor who understands hygrothermal dynamics, envelope behaviour, and HVAC interaction will look beyond the remediated surface to identify whether conditions that created the original mold problem have genuinely been resolved. Moisture readings are taken across structural materials using calibrated instruments. Thermal imaging is frequently used to identify anomalies behind surfaces that cannot be observed directly. If there is any indication that moisture sources remain active, the clearance process pauses until those sources are addressed.
Step Three: Air and Surface Sampling
Sampling is the scientific core of the mold clearance certificate Dubai process. Air samples are typically collected using spore trap cassettes and analysed under microscopy by an accredited laboratory. Surface samples may be collected using tape lifts, swabs, or bulk material analysis depending on the surface type and what the visual inspection indicated. Sampling follows a comparative protocol: samples from the remediated area are compared to an outdoor reference sample collected at the same time, and to non-affected control areas within the property. This comparison is how elevated spore counts are distinguished from ambient background levels that are normal in any outdoor-adjacent environment.
Step Four: Laboratory Analysis

Laboratory analysis identifies mold genera and species present, quantifies spore concentrations, and flags any species of particular note — such as Stachybotrys chartarum or Aspergillus niger — that carry additional significance in the interpretation of results.
Step Five: Report and Certificate Issuance
If laboratory results confirm that spore concentrations in the remediated area are consistent with or below outdoor reference levels, and no elevated surface contamination is detected, the mold clearance certificate is issued. The report accompanying the certificate documents the full methodology, all sample results, and the professional’s conclusions. If results indicate residual contamination, the report specifies which areas require further remediation before clearance can be confirmed. A second assessment is then scheduled following the additional work.
Variables That Affect the Scope of a Mold Clearance Assessment
A professional assessment determines the scope of any mold clearance engagement. There is no meaningful standardised fee structure because the scope varies significantly between properties. - Property size and type: A studio apartment and a six-bedroom villa in Emirates Hills require fundamentally different assessment approaches. More surface area, more rooms, and more HVAC zones mean more sampling points and more laboratory analysis.
- Age and construction method of the building: Older buildings in Deira, Bur Dubai, or Satwa may have materials and assemblies that hold moisture differently from newer construction. Some older properties have had multiple layers of finishes applied over original surfaces, complicating visual access and sampling.
- Extent of the original contamination: A clearance assessment following a minor bathroom mold remediation differs substantially from one following extensive remediation of an HVAC system and multiple rooms in a large villa.
- Number of sampling locations required: IAC2 and IICRC guidelines suggest minimum sampling locations, but complex properties or extensive remediation projects require more points to achieve representative data.
- Occupancy status: Occupied properties with sensitive individuals — children, elderly occupants, or those with respiratory conditions — may warrant a more comprehensive sampling protocol to achieve a higher degree of certainty.
- Whether HVAC systems were involved in the remediation: HVAC-related mold cases require specific sampling of supply and return air pathways, which adds both field time and laboratory processing to the scope.

What Distinguishes a Credible Mold Clearance Certificate
Not every document labelled a mold clearance certificate carries equal weight. Several markers distinguish a scientifically credible certificate from one that offers limited practical assurance. This relates directly to Mold Clearance Certificate Dubai: What It Means.
A credible certificate is backed by laboratory data from an accredited or in-house laboratory with documented chain of custody for samples. It is issued by a professional with verifiable credentials — IAC2 certification, building science training, or equivalent recognised qualifications. It follows a defined methodology aligned with IICRC S520 or comparable international protocols for mold assessment and remediation.
The report should be auditable — meaning a third party reviewing the same data could reach the same conclusion. If a certificate cannot be supported by its underlying data when examined, it provides no meaningful assurance to the property owner, buyer, or regulatory authority reviewing it. Mold Clearance Certificate Dubai Implications for Property Transactions
For real estate professionals and buyers operating in Dubai’s property market, mold clearance documentation is becoming a more common component of due diligence, particularly for older villa communities and properties that have experienced water damage or HVAC-related issues. A mold clearance certificate does not guarantee a property will remain free of mold indefinitely — that outcome depends on ongoing moisture management, HVAC maintenance, and building envelope integrity. What it does confirm is that at the point of assessment, following remediation conducted to a documented standard, the indoor environment met the clearance criteria established by the assessing professional using laboratory-confirmed data.
For landlords, this documentation also creates a defensible record of environmental condition at a specific date, which carries value in the context of tenancy transitions and any subsequent disputes about property condition. Expert Observations on the Mold Clearance Certificate Dubai Process
Based on field investigations conducted across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and Sharjah over more than a decade, several patterns recur in clearance assessments that are worth noting.
First, clearance assessments conducted too soon after remediation — before materials have fully dried or before HVAC systems have been returned to normal operation — frequently yield inconclusive results, requiring reassessment and adding time to the process. Allowing adequate stabilisation time is not a delay; it is a necessary condition for reliable data. Mold Clearance Certificate Dubai: What It Means factors into this consideration.
Second, the areas most likely to fail clearance are not always the areas most visibly treated. HVAC return plenums, wall cavities adjacent to remediated surfaces, and areas where moisture sources were incompletely resolved tend to appear in laboratory results more often than the primary remediation zone itself.
Third, properties where the root cause of mold growth was not addressed before remediation consistently fail clearance or experience recurrence. A mold clearance certificate Dubai assessment that uncovers an unresolved moisture source is delivering valuable information, even if it delays the certificate. Frequently Asked Questions
What exactly does a mold clearance certificate Dubai confirm?
A mold clearance certificate Dubai confirms, based on post-remediation visual inspection and laboratory-analysed air and surface samples, that mold contamination in a specified area has been reduced to levels consistent with acceptable indoor environmental benchmarks. It is a documented, data-supported statement of condition, not simply a sign-off that cleaning was performed.
Who is qualified to issue a mold clearance certificate in Dubai?
A mold clearance certificate should be issued by a qualified indoor environmental professional with verifiable credentials — such as IAC2 certification or equivalent — who operates independently of the remediation contractor. The assessor must have access to an accredited laboratory for sample analysis. Self-certification by the remediation company does not meet the standard of independence required for credible clearance documentation. How long does the mold clearance certificate Dubai assessment process take?
The timeline varies by property size and laboratory processing time. Field assessment typically requires several hours for a standard villa or apartment. Laboratory results for air and surface samples generally take between two and five business days. The full process from field visit to certificate issuance commonly falls within one week, assuming the property passes clearance on the first assessment.
Can a mold clearance certificate be required for property sales in Dubai?
While not universally mandated by Dubai Land Department for every transaction, mold clearance certificates are increasingly requested by buyers conducting due diligence, particularly for older villas and properties with documented water damage history. Sellers, agents, and property managers in Dubai should be aware that professional buyers may include environmental clearance as a condition of offer. What happens if my property does not pass mold clearance assessment?
If laboratory results indicate residual mold contamination above clearance thresholds, the assessment report will specify which areas require additional remediation. A second clearance assessment is then conducted after that work is completed. Failing clearance is not a failure of the property — it is the verification process functioning correctly, protecting the owner from incomplete remediation.
Does a mold clearance certificate cover HVAC systems in Dubai properties?
Only if HVAC systems were included in the scope of the remediation and assessment. HVAC-related mold cases in Dubai are common due to high humidity loads and variable maintenance standards. If the HVAC system was involved in the contamination, clearance sampling should include air quality verification from supply registers and, where accessible, assessment of duct interiors. Is there a difference between a mold clearance certificate and an indoor air quality report in Dubai?
Yes. A mold clearance certificate is specifically a post-remediation document confirming that remediation met clearance criteria. An indoor air quality report is a broader assessment of environmental conditions that may or may not relate to a remediation event. Both involve sampling and laboratory analysis, but they serve different purposes and answer different questions about the indoor environment.
